Jason Puncheon Says Crystal Palace Shouldn't Be Scared Of Manchester City
Despite five consecutive defeats in their opening five Premier League games Crystal Palace's captain Jason Puncheon insists the eagles will not be panicking despite a daunting of playing Manchester City on Saturday.
The woes of the London side may not get better in the coming weeks as they will face trips to Manchester United and champions Chelsea in less than a month. The Eagles are in fine form in the Carabao Cup and are into the last 16, but it is in the League that results are more in need. Goalless and Pointless, the Eagles are in dire need of a miracle as they travel to a ruthless Manchester City on Saturday.
"We've improved in the last two games and on another day those chances might have gone in", Puncheon said "but that's football and that's where we are as a team. As a group of players we must stick together and not let the negativity set in.
"Roy [Hodgson] has made an impact already. He wants us to be more compact and difficult to beat. We did that at times against Southampton but it's going to be a long process.
"The manager told us it's a 33-game season and nothing will be decided by Christmas-but we obviously need to start picking up results.
"Roy told us after the Southampton game to keep our heads and not let the pressure get to us. We've been here before as a group of players - we'll get ourselves out of this.
"The gaffer wants us to work on shape and it will take us time to get used to his methods. But we all have to pull in the right direction and this team will never lose due to lack of efforts, we'll go down fighting.
"In the Premier League it's all about getting three points. We go into every game knowing we're capable of producing a big performance. We'll go into those games as underdogs but the squad just needs to focus on our performance and block out any negative coverage."
Wilfred Zaha is unavailable for the Eagles as he recovers from a knee injury but it's not all doom and gloom as Mammadou Sakho had some minutes in the victory against Huddersfield on Tuesday.
Sakho's return for Palace is timely as they will face barrage of attacks from a City side with 11 goals in their last two games. Hodgson may find it Pertinent to 'Park The Bus' against Man City and a point will be precious and will surely be a morale booster for his group of players.
